Alkylation of biphenyl and methylbiphenyls by Me2F+ and Me2Cl+ ions has been studied in the gas phase by a combination of radiolytic and mass spectrometric techniques, including chemical ionization and collisionally induced dissociation spectrometry.The results, in particular, the disproportionately high extent of ortho substitution, conform to a mechanistic model envisaging, in addition to direct substitution, the preliminary formation of an electrostatically bound adduct between the symmetric, bidentate electrophile and both rings of the substrate.Formation of the adduct increases the local concentration of the electrophile, hence the rate of alkylation at the ortho positions of biphenyl.
